Haiti - Constitution : «This is a victory for the women»

The principle of the minimum quota of 30% of women's participation in national life was voted in the amendment of the Constitution of 1987.

Article 16.1 is replaced by article 17.1 which is read as follows:

"The principle of the quota of at least thirty percent (30%) of women is recognized at all levels of national life, particularly in public services"

"This is a victory for the women" has declared Marie Laurence Jocelyn Lassègue, Minister of Culture and Communication [former Minister of the Status of Women and Women's Rights], who was present to the Parliament during the session of amendment [...] The thing to understand is that in nominative positions, there is a majority of men, which does not reflect social reality. The social reality is that many women educates children in single parent families, they are numerous to take their responsibility, and are not very present in government or public administration."

Marie Laurence Jocelyn Lassègue expressed her satisfaction with the vote "which will enable the majority of the population to enjoy their political rights..." while calling women to remain mobilized and vigilant in order that the principle of 30% quota of women in public affairs is respected.
